Output aaced1c4a04ccc0f022fa58a1726d8918dbbafae9a9d3e25bae12e3544a1ca08:0

value
573956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25eb7b84c97640b2b530636b20db152d085dfe20 OP_EQUAL
address
359X2FaCUdT5Ho55v3DnUWBKYVQq8s3fAY
transaction
aaced1c4a04ccc0f022fa58a1726d8918dbbafae9a9d3e25bae12e3544a1ca08
confirmations
42648
spent
true